PARK AND RIDE


Meaning of PARK AND RIDE in English

noun

a system designed to reduce traffic in towns in which people park their cars on the edge of a town and then take a special bus or train to the town centre; the area where people park their cars before taking the bus :

Use the park and ride.

I've left my car in the park and ride.

a park-and-ride service

Oxford Advanced Learner's English Dictionary.      Оксфордский английский словарь для изучающик язык на продвинутом уровне.